How they compare
Ethiopia currently reports 15.8% against 15.2% in Nicaragua, a difference of 0.6%.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 22 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Ethiopia ahead.
Ethiopia ranks 55th and Nicaragua ranks 58th of 168 countries.
Ethiopia has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Ethiopia | Nicaragua |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 33.3% | 31.8% | 1.5% | Ethiopia |
| 2010s | 47.1% | 27.9% | 19.2% | Ethiopia |
| 2020s | 20.5% | 12.9% | 7.6% | Ethiopia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Raw data are from Bankscope. Data10270[t] / ((data2055[t] + data2055[t-1])/2). Numerator and denominator are first aggregated on the country level before division. Note that banks used in the calculation might differ between indicators. Calculated from underlying bank-by-bank unconsolidated data from Bankscope.
